Rangers To Replace Jeff Banister As Manager

The Texas Rangers plan to replace Jeff Banister as their manager before the end of the season, according to sources. The 54-year-old will not return for a fifth season in 2019 despite helping the team to division titles in 2015 and 2016. The Rangers will complete their second straight losing season in 2018. Taylor Lewan Clears Concussion Protocol

Tennessee Titans left tackle Taylor Lewan (concussion) has cleared the concussion protocol and should be active in Week 3 against the Jaguars. Against a strong pass rush of the Jaguars, this is excellent news for whoever is under center for the Titans this Sunday.

Jadeveon Clowney Expected To Play

Houston Texans head coach Bill O'Brien said it looks like defensive end Jadeveon Clowney (back) will be able to play in Week 3 against the Giants. The oft-injured Clowney missed last week but should be able to return on Sunday. He's a must-start in IDP leagues if he's active against a weak Giants offensive line.
